    Retired Worcester Police Officer, Earl J. Goslow, 73, of Worcester, passed away unexpectedly in his sleep Thursday, November 25th 2010 in his home.
    Earl was born February 23, 1937 in Worcester a son of Charles and Catherine (Koroniak) Goslow. He graduated from Commerce High, joined and served in the U.S. Marine Corps during the Korean War Era. Upon return he then earned his associates degree from the University of Connecticut where he played basketball and has lived here all his life.
    Earl is survived by his wife Joanna (Noccella) Goslow; a devoted son, John P. Goslow and his wife Evelyn Goslow; Two Cherished grandchildren, Dylan Goslow and Kimberly Andujar; a brother Dennis Goslow of Worcester; nieces, nephews, extended family and a host of friends. A brother, Charles and a sister Carol Goslow pre deceased him.
    Earl worked more than 27 years as a Police Officer for the City of Worcester before retiring in 2002.
    Earl was a member of the International Brotherhood of Police Officers Union, The Worcester Police Relief and Credit Unions, The Massachusetts Police Association and the Marine Corps League Detachment 114.
